Modeling and Implementation of a Distributed
Shop Floor Management and Control System
*

 

Liu Shiping  Rao Yunqing  Zhang Jie  Li Peigen

School of Mechanical Science and Engineering, Huazhong University of Science and Technology,
 Wuhan 430074, China

 

Abstract:  Adopting distributed control architecture is the important development direction for shop floor management and control system, is also the requirement of making it agile, intelligent and concurrent. Some key problems in achieving distributed control architecture are researched. An activity model of shop floor is presented as the requirement definition of the prototype system. The multi-agent based software architecture is constructed. How the core part in shop floor management and control system, production plan and scheduling is achieved. The cooperation of different agents is illustrated. Finally, the implementation of the prototype system is narrated.

Key words: Agent  Shop floor management and control  CIMS
